Research Interests

Developing new/alternative procedures for chemical analysis with environmental friendly purposes, such as use of less solvents/reagent and/or being automation. This would be in a part of green analytical chemistry by aiming to downscale as well as flow analysis techniques including flow injection analysis (FIA) and related techniques.
